The municipal police officers, the firefighters and the 118 paramedics took turns in vain in cardiac massage in an attempt to revive him.

A 72-year-old French tourist lost his life this morning while visiting the Cathedral of Monreale. The man, on vacation in Sicily, was on the roof of the famous Norman cathedral when he suddenly fell ill and died. Firefighters responded immediately to the scene, called to deal with the […] The article "Tragedy in Monreale: 72-Year-Old French Man Feels Unwell and Dies on the Roof of the Cathedral" comes from Diretta Sicilia.
